We had a really quiet drive down to Kieliekrankie and we were beginning to wonder if the next “barren” spell was starting. We had had the lion sighting yesterday, but nothing since. :-? :-?


We stopped for a break at Melkvlei and had resigned ourselves to getting to our accommodation a lot earlier than expected.

We were SO wrong....

Debbie was driving the final stint, and we were busy chatting when she suddenly slammed on breaks.
“just get your camera” she said as she slowly reversed the bakkie and trailer
WHY?
Oh my hat. Then I saw her. O/\ O/\

Gorid in a tree right next to the road.
